Republican Senator Lisa Murkowski has announced her opposition to Todd Blanche’s nomination for Attorney General. This move significantly jeopardizes Blanche’s confirmation, as Murkowski’s vote is crucial in a closely divided Senate. Her decision stems from undisclosed concerns regarding Blanche’s qualifications or past work, though specifics have not been publicly stated. The confirmation process was already expected to be challenging, but Murkowski’s opposition adds a layer of uncertainty. Without her support, Blanche will likely struggle to secure the necessary votes for approval. The White House is reportedly working to sway Murkowski, but her stance appears firm at this time. This development underscores the delicate balance of power in the Senate and the potential for even qualified nominees to face roadblocks.
